The size of Wallangarra is approximately 37.1 square kilometres. It has 1 park covering nearly 0.5% of total area. The population of Wallangarra in 2011 was 511 people. By 2016 the population was 474 showing a population decline of 7.2%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Wallangarra is 60-69 years. Households in Wallangarra are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1000 - $1399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Wallangarra work in a labourer occupation. In 2011, 65.2% of the homes in Wallangarra were owner-occupied compared with 69% in 2016.
